Chief Superintendent: EMPD Basic Training - EMPD19469

Closing Date : 2024-09-05
Department : Ekurhuleni Metropolitan Police Department (2019)
Location
City of Ekurhuleni
Remuneration
R 632,664.00 to R 867,924.00 - Basic salary per annum (plus benefits)
Assignment Type
Permanent

Minimum Requirements:

  • Grade 12
  • Valid Driver's License (At least code B)
  • No criminal record
  • Metro Police Qualification from an institution accredited by the RTMC (Road Traffic Management Corporation) comprising of: Traffic Officer Diploma & Law Enforcement Skills Certificate
  • Registered as Traffic Officer
  • OD-ETDP Qualification (Occupationally Directed Education Training and Development Practices or Relevant Diploma or Higher Certificate: on NQF Level 5 or equivalent thereof
  • Registered as an Assessor, Moderator
  • Registered Skills Development Facilitator.
  • Advanced Diploma / B-Tech /Bachelor's Degree: Policing/ Traffic Management/ Law Enforcement on NQF level 6 will be an added advantage
  • 3 years' experience as Inspector/Superintendent or equivalent role
  • 2 years' experience in law Enforcement/Police Training Environment

Core Responsibilities:

  • Oversee the preparation and planning of learning and training material.
  • Oversee the facilitation and presenting of training programmes to achieve learning outcomes.
  • Manage the assessment of learner’s level of achievement and competency.
  • Manage the measurement of quality, impact and success of the learning programmes.
  • Oversee that the assessment outcome is fair, valid and reliable by ensuring that assessment criteria was consistent.
  • Coordinate and participate in ad-hoc/special Law Enforcement and crime prevention operations.
  • Manage domestic violence complaints and incidents according to the Domestic Violence Act.
  • Ensure that the Division is effective and efficient through administration processes.
  • Promote the image of EMPD through maintain good public relations in accordance to the Batho Pele principles.
